Course Description

Dive into the world of film and slide digitization in our interactive workshop, tailored for both photography beginners, seasoned professionals, or those with a trove of family photos that need digitization. Utilizing the Photo Center’s Epson flatbed film scanners, participants will master the intricacies of scanning, from handling delicate negatives and slides to perfecting image resolution settings. Emphasis will be placed on color correction, scan settings, film cleaning, and techniques to ensure your digital reproductions are of the highest quality. Throughout the workshop, you’ll receive instruction to fine-tune your scanning process and harness the full potential of the Epson scanning technology. Join us to transform your cherished analog memories into stunning digital formats! Prior experience with macOS and Adobe Photoshop is beneficial. Participants need to bring 35mm or medium format film negatives or slides to scan.

Requirements

Please bring a laptop with current version of Adobe Photoshop or Lightroom. Photo Center Orientation is not required for this class, but it is required if student wishes to come to the Photo Center outside the workshop to develop film on their own and/or print their own photos in the Darkroom.
